Married Filed Jointly – Economic Stimulus Payment In One Check Or Two And Based On Who’s Ssan?

My husband and I filed jointly on our 2007 tax return. I am wondering if we’ll get one economic stimulus check for each of us- or will they be sending it lumped into one check? Also- there’s a payment schedule online based on social security numbers, but will the check(s) be sent based on my SSAN or my husband’s? Thanks for any input.

  • The stimulus payment refund will be mailed or direct depositied in one lump sum. The IRS will deliver based on the primary social security number that was used to file your 2007 taxes. If your husband was put as the head of houshold then the IRS will use the last 2 digits of his social security number.
